What is a Health Coach?

Using a range of specialist coaching tools and techniques, a Health Coach works with clients to set realistic goals that can easily be achieved.

There are many different types of Coaches. A good Health Coach knows how the body works, understands the importance of fitness, has a good basic knowledge of nutrition and is trained to educate, empower and support clients to make positive changes to improve their health and take control of their lives.

Health coaching enables people to create real change in every aspect of their lives, including their diet, fitness levels, career, relationships, home environment and general wellness. Health coaches can assist with a range of health-related issues including weight loss, stress, digestive problems, blood sugar regulation and detoxification.
